Homocysteine 15μmol/L is generally not a concern. The

Is homocysteine 15 important?

normal range for homocysteine is 5-15μmol/L, and homocysteine 15μmol/L is within the normal range, so it is usually not a concern. However, since homocysteine 15μmol/L is at a critical level, it is recommended that patients visit the hospital regularly for homocysteine testing. If the test results show that homocysteine is higher than the normal range, it is an abnormal phenomenon, which may be related to hypothyroidism, liver disease and other diseases. At this time, it should be combined with other examinations to clarify the cause, such as thyroid function test, abdominal B-ultrasound, abdominal magnetic resonance imaging,

etc.
